Semitransparent indium-tin-oxide-free non-fullerene organic photodetectors with double-side ultraviolet selective responses

摘要

Visibly transparent organic photodetectors have drawn lots of attention for low-cost processing, mechanical flexibility or wavelength selectivity to be utilized in various fields including private households and industrial & military application. They can be fabricated by combining transparent conductive electrodes with desired transmission window and organic donor & acceptor composites with selective absorption range outside the visible wavelength. Here, we demonstrate an indium-tin-oxide-free, fullerene-free, ultraviolet detective, visibly transparent organic photodetector with an average visible transmittance of 46.7% and a similar-spectral, double-side responsivity to the ultraviolet light. At a wavelength of 350 nm and under -10 V, the specific detectivity can be 10(10) Jones. (C) 2018 Elsevier B.V. All rights reserved.
